Step 7: Pin the planner behavior before upgrading. The Ledgerwren 4.2 query planner has a regression where certain filtered joins skip the row-level policy check path — not a data leak on its own, but worth your attention since it changes which code path enforces policies. We're pinning the old planner until the 4.2.3 patch lands. Nothing here widens access; it just keeps enforcement on the audited path. The pin is applied at startup via the following configuration values.

config for kafof-bawef:
holath:
  log_level: debug
  metrics_host: metrics.holath.qorvelsys.internal
  pin: 2191
  pool_size: 32

Handover note — to the incoming warehouse shift lead at Bramblewick Depot. The sealed exam papers for the Orlen Institute autumn sitting arrived on pallet row C, crate 4, tamper seals intact and logged. Do not break the outer banding; the seals must be verified again by the invigilation officer on arrival. The courier from Fenholt Express is booked for 06:30 tomorrow. Before release, note the following confidential hand-over instruction:

dispatch memo: the lamwyn fenwyn courier leaves the wenir ledger at gate 7175 under passcode 822969

## Rebalancer Dispatch Runbook — PedalFlow Ops

Before approving a rebalancing run, verify that the CycleShift planner only reads dock occupancy from the signed telemetry feed and never from operator overrides. Each dispatch batch is cryptographically sealed by the Harborline scheduler, and the seal must validate before trucks are routed. If validation fails, the run aborts and nothing is persisted. For audit purposes, every approved batch records the exact planner build that produced it. The token for this run appears below.

trace token, yagag-bageg: htk4_b40e